| Room | Primary Mood | Key Features | Lighting Preference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Living Room | Social & Relaxed | Comfortable seating, fireplace, art | Warm, layered lighting |
| Kitchen | Energetic & Functional | Large counter, storage, appliances | Bright task lighting |
| Bedroom | Calm & Restful | Soft textiles, quiet palette | Adjustable, dimmable light |
| Workspace | Focused & Inspired | Organized tools, natural view | Cool, concentrated light |

Upkeep and Home Maintenance
Seasonal Checks and Small Repairs
Regular tasks like checking filters, cleaning gutters, and tightening fixtures keep my sweet home running smoothly. A simple seasonal checklist prevents small issues from becoming big problems.
Everyday Choices for a Lasting Sweet Home
- Define a calm, cohesive color palette to guide future purchases
- Optimize traffic flow by keeping main paths clear and unblocked
- Invest in quality lighting layers for different activities and times of day
- Rotate decor seasonally to refresh the atmosphere without major changes
- Set a simple maintenance schedule to protect surfaces and systems
- Create dedicated zones for work, rest, and socializing within the same rooms

How do I balance comfort with functionality in my sweet home?
Prioritize versatile furniture, clear storage solutions, and flexible layouts that support both relaxation and daily tasks without sacrificing warmth.
What are the most common design mistakes to avoid in a sweet home?
Overcrowding rooms with furniture, ignoring natural light paths, and choosing style over comfort can quickly make a home feel less inviting.
How can I personalize my space without overspending?
Use artwork, textiles, and small accents to express personality, and focus on quality pieces that align with your long term vision rather than trends.
What role does lighting play in making a house feel like a sweet home?
Layered lighting, including ambient, task, and accent sources, shapes mood, highlights key areas, and allows the home to adapt through the day.
